Christopher Delvaille

Strategic Planning & Development Principal (program Development Division) at Compassion International

Christopher Delvaille has extensive experience in strategic planning and program development, currently serving as the Strategic Planning & Development Principal at Compassion International since September 2005. In this Chief of Staff role, Christopher supports the Vice President of Program Development, overseeing a division that develops interventions for over 2 million children in poverty across 26 countries. Previous roles at Compassion include Manager of Program Effectiveness Research and Senior Strategy & Planning Advisor, where Christopher facilitated strategy frameworks and led the creation of new offices focusing on monitoring and evaluation. Christopher's earlier experience at Providence Housing Authority involved managing the Office of Policy & Planning and authoring the award-winning Strategic Plan 2000. Christopher holds a Master of Community Planning from the University of Rhode Island and a Bachelor of Arts in Government from Connecticut College.
